Herois do Forró started as Trio Forrozão in Caruaru, Pernambuco, in the early 2000s. They built a local following with a sound rooted in the forró traditions of Brazil's northeast. The band later changed their name to Herois do Forró, which stuck as they gained more attention.
Their music includes songs like 'Princesa' and 'Saudades', which carry the rhythmic drive typical of forró. They released albums such as 'Forró de Verdade' in 2006 and 'Amado Batista em Forró' in 2007, blending covers and original material.
At times, they faced criticism over questions of authenticity and artistic borrowing, but kept playing and recording. Their work stayed focused on the genre's core instruments and danceable beats, without much shift in style.
